    About Velda

    Velda is a striking choice for parents drawn to names with a vintage charm and a strong, decisive sound. This Germanic name, meaning "power" or "rule," carries an undeniable mid-century flair, evoking images of a bygone era without feeling dusty. Its rarity is a significant draw, offering a distinctive alternative to more common vintage revivals. Unlike many names from its era that have seen a resurgence, Velda remains delightfully uncommon, ensuring a unique identity for a child without being overly obscure. It's a name that feels both grounded and spirited, perfect for a little girl with a commanding presence and an independent spirit.
